Some England soccer fans watching the Women’s World Cup back home were already starting to prepare for the final as soon as the eruption of excitement dissipated and the dancing died down.

England fans react as England win their match, as they watch a screening of the Women’s World Cup 2023 semifinal soccer match between England and Australia at BOXPARK Wembley in London, Wednesday, Aug. 16, 2023. England will play Spain in the final of the Women’s World Cup on Sunday after beating co-hosts Australia 3-1 in the semi-final in Sydney.
